Timeline

Day 1

09:00 – 16:30 History and Fundamentals of Ethereum
  • The evolution of digital money: from early concepts (1975–2008) to Bitcoin (2008–2009)
  • The rise of Ethereum (2015) and its role in Blockchain 2.0
  • Overview of alternative platforms: Hyperledger (2015)
  • How Ethereum is used – Ether, ERC-20, ERC-721, and smart contracts
  • Blockchain 2.0 principles: decentralization and permanence
  • How Ethereum works: mining vs. non-mining nodes, PoW vs. PoS, Ethereum 2.0 upgrade
  • Gas fees and performance optimization

Day 2

09:00 – 16:30 Designing and Securing Ethereum Applications
  • Blockchain application structure and system layers
  • Voting demo application – architecture and logic
  • Solution design considerations and best practices
  • IPFS and IoTA – decentralized storage and data layers
  • Deterministic concurrency and performance considerations
  • Smart contract security best practices
  • Public vs. private network instances
  • Preparation for hands-on lab environment

Day 3

09:00 – 16:30 Ethereum Development Hands-On Labs
  • Working with Remix IDE
  • Using MetaMask and test networks
  • Integration with Infura.io and Web3.js
  • Handling events, function modifiers, mappings, and structs
  • Smart contract inheritance and architecture
  • Deploying to live networks
  • Creating your own ERC-20 token
  • Creating your own ERC-721 (NFT) token
  • Environment recommendations (x86 required; ARM M1 not currently supported)

What is Blockchain?

Blockchain is a revolutionary technology that is changing the way we understand and use the Internet. It is a decentralized data recording system that allows information to be stored in the form of "blocks" connected in a "chain". Each block contains a certain amount of data and a reference to the previous block. This structure creates an immutable and transparent database that is distributed among different computers or nodes in a network.

Blockchain is therefore like an unbreakable digital diary that records and stores transactions and events so securely that they cannot be changed or manipulated. With Blockchain, we can create trust and ensure data integrity in everything from finance to healthcare and logistics.

What is Blockchain Training Alliance (BTA)?

The Blockchain Training Alliance (BTA) is an international educational organization founded in 2017 that specializes in training and certification in blockchain, Web3 technologies, and digital innovation. It collaborates with leading global companies such as Microsoft, Cisco, and Disney, and provides both corporate and individual educational programs. BTA certifications are recognized worldwide and help professionals validate their knowledge of modern technologies and advance their careers in the rapidly growing blockchain industry.

How are the BTA exams conducted?

  • After purchasing a trial voucher, the "Launch Exam" option will be activated in the BTA user portal.

  • The exam is taken online – students begin the exam directly on the portal and cannot leave it during the exam.

  • Format: mostly multiple-choice questions, often performance-based, meaning that the questions are designed to simulate real-life work situations.

  • Result: Immediately after completing the exam, the result will be displayed on the portal as PASS/FAIL and a percentage score. It is not possible to obtain a detailed breakdown of individual questions (e.g., which ones you answered incorrectly).

  • The minimum threshold for success is usually 70%.
